Android 16: Unveiling the Next Iteration
While Google recently hosted The Android Show, a dedicated event for Android updates, the main I/O event is expected to delve even deeper into the intricacies of Android 16. The Android Show highlighted improvements in locating lost devices, enhanced security features within the Advanced Protection program, and a visually striking new design language dubbed Material 3 Expressive. However, I/O promises a more comprehensive look at what Android 16 has in store for users.
Android 16 is rumored to focus heavily on user experience enhancements. While not necessarily a radical overhaul, the update is expected to refine existing features and introduce a wealth of quality-of-life improvements. Enhanced notifications are anticipated, offering more control and customization options.
One particularly exciting addition is support for Auracast, a Bluetooth technology that simplifies the process of switching between Bluetooth devices. This feature promises to be a boon for users who frequently juggle multiple audio devices, streamlining the pairing and connection process.
Furthermore, Android 16 is rumored to bring lock screen widgets, allowing users to access key information and perform quick actions without unlocking their devices. This feature could significantly enhance convenience and efficiency, particularly for accessing frequently used apps or information snippets.
Accessibility is also expected to be a major focus in Android 16, with a range of new features designed to make the operating system more inclusive and user-friendly for individuals with disabilities. While specific details remain scarce, these accessibility enhancements could encompass a variety of areas, such as improved voice control, enhanced screen readers, and customizable display options.
Beyond Android 16, Google may also use I/O as a platform to highlight the latest developments in Android XR, its operating system for mixed reality devices, and Wear OS, the company’s software for smartwatches and other wearables. The advancements in these platforms reflect Google’s commitment to expanding into emerging technologies.
Gemini and the AI Revolution
Artificial intelligence is undeniably the dominant force shaping the tech landscape, and Google is making significant strides in this field. Gemini, Google’s flagship family of AI models, is poised to take center stage at I/O. Attendees can anticipate the unveiling of new additions and upgrades to the Gemini lineup, showcasing Google’s commitment to pushing the boundaries of AI capabilities.
Leaks and rumors suggest that an updated version of Gemini Ultra, Google’s most powerful AI model, is on the horizon. This upgrade could bring significant improvements in areas such as natural language processing, image recognition, and overall performance. The improved Gemini Ultra is likely to power even more sophisticated AI applications and services.
The introduction of an upgraded Gemini Ultra model could also pave the way for a revised Gemini subscription structure. Currently, Google offers a single premium tier, Gemini Advanced, which unlocks enhanced features and capabilities in the Gemini chatbot. However, there is speculation that Google may introduce two new plans, Premium Plus and Premium Pro, offering even more advanced features and potentially catering to different user needs and price points. The exact pricing and benefits of these new plans remain to be seen, but they could represent a significant shift in Google’s AI monetization strategy.
Beyond the core Gemini models, Google is also expected to showcase its progress on other AI initiatives, such as Astra and Project Mariner. Astra represents Google’s ambitious effort to develop AI agents capable of real-time, multimodal understanding. These agents could potentially interact with the world in a more natural and intuitive way, opening up new possibilities for human-computer interaction.
Project Mariner, another intriguing AI initiative, focuses on developing AI agents that can navigate and take actions across the web on a user’s behalf. This technology could revolutionize how users interact with the internet, automating tasks and streamlining online experiences. References to "Computer Use" within Google’s AI Studio developer platform suggest that Project Mariner may be closer to realization than previously thought.

Unexpected Surprises and Hidden Gems
Google I/O is known for its unexpected surprises and hidden gems. Last year, Google unveiled LearnLM, a set of AI models fine-tuned for education applications. This year, attendees can expect similar surprises.
One potential surprise could be an upgrade to NotebookLM, Google’s AI-powered podcast-generating tool that gained viral popularity. Leaked code suggests that a “Video Overviews” tool is in development, potentially creating video summaries using Google’s Veo 2 video-generating model. This would be an exciting development for content creators and consumers alike. Also, expect more news on Project Q, which will enhance the way that AI powers search results.
